Q. Who among the following contemporaries of Ashoka have been mentioned in Major Rock Edict XIII?
Antiochus II Theos of Syria
Ptolemy II Philadelpus of Egypt
Antigonus Gonatus of Macedonia
Magas of Cyrene
Alexander of Epirus
Choose the correct answer using the codes given below: Answer:
1, 2, 3, 4 & 5
Notes:
Asoka, in his Major Rock Edict XIII, mentions many of his contemporaries in the Hellenic world with whom he exchanged missions, diplomatic and otherwise. The five kings are Antiyoka, Turamaya, Antikini, Maka and Alikasudara. These have been identified as Antiochus II Theos of Syria (grandson of Seleucus Nikator), Ptolemy II Philadelpus of Egypt, Antigonus Gonatus of Macedonia, Magas of Cyrene and Alexander of Epirus.
